|
@@ -5238,16 +5238,16 @@ public class GameDataServiceImpl implements IGameDataService {
|
|
|
}
|
|
|
|
|
|
//校验订单时间,必须包含在消耗时间内
|
|
|
- if(dto.getOrderBeginDate()!=null && dto.getOrderEndDate()!=null){
|
|
|
- //如果订单选择范围开始时间在消耗之前,那么就将订单时间设置为消耗开始时间
|
|
|
- if(dto.getOrderBeginDate().isBefore(dto.getCostBeginDate())){
|
|
|
- dto.setOrderBeginDate(dto.getCostBeginDate());
|
|
|
- }
|
|
|
- //如果订单选择范围结束时间在消耗之后,那么就将订单时间设置为消耗结束时间
|
|
|
- if(dto.getOrderEndDate().isAfter(dto.getCostEndDate())){
|
|
|
- dto.setOrderEndDate(dto.getCostEndDate());
|
|
|
- }
|
|
|
- }
|
|
|
+// if(dto.getOrderBeginDate()!=null && dto.getOrderEndDate()!=null){
|
|
|
+// //如果订单选择范围开始时间在消耗之前,那么就将订单时间设置为消耗开始时间
|
|
|
+// if(dto.getOrderBeginDate().isBefore(dto.getCostBeginDate())){
|
|
|
+// dto.setOrderBeginDate(dto.getCostBeginDate());
|
|
|
+// }
|
|
|
+// //如果订单选择范围结束时间在消耗之后,那么就将订单时间设置为消耗结束时间
|
|
|
+// if(dto.getOrderEndDate().isAfter(dto.getCostEndDate())){
|
|
|
+// dto.setOrderEndDate(dto.getCostEndDate());
|
|
|
+// }
|
|
|
+// }
|
|
|
|
|
|
//如果订单时间为空,那么就最多查询消耗结束时间当天和前一天的数据
|
|
|
if(dto.getOrderBeginDate()==null && dto.getOrderEndDate()==null){
|